**Mgmt Meeting Minutes — Retiring the Brightline Range**

Quick recap for sales leads at Fenholt Supplies: we agreed to retire the Brightline fixture range by year-end. Remaining stock moves to clearance pricing next month, and accounts on standing orders get migrated to the Lumetta range. Trade-in incentives were approved in principle. The confidential note on next steps sits just below.

board note of bajof-bajeg: The pricing group signed off on a budget of $13.4 million for Project Sildor. The renewal with Lamixek Holdings closes at $48.9 million a year, 49 percent above the last contract.

**14:22** — Support reports ResizeRook CLI hanging on batches over 400 images. **14:31** — Confirmed: worker pool deadlocks when the thumbnail and watermark stages contend for the same temp directory lock. **14:48** — Hotfix applied, serializing temp allocation. **15:05** — Verified against the Pemberly photo archive test set; throughput normal. Support can tell customers to upgrade immediately; older binaries remain affected. For escalations, reference the exact hotfix build, identified by the token directly below this entry.

trace token, fafog-kageg: htk4_98e6

## Configuration

Digestline schedules batch email digests via three variables. `DIGEST_CRON` controls send timing and accepts standard cron syntax; `DIGEST_BATCH_SIZE` should stay at or below 500 to avoid throttling; `DIGEST_TZ` defaults to the Marlowe region. Reviewers should confirm all three are present before approving. Finally, the mailer requires its delivery credential, which appears on the next line.

sealed setting: ARCHIVE_KEY3=8d0

### Account Recovery — Catalogue Import (Lintwood)

Quick one for review: when the Lintwood catalogue import wipes a patron's session table, the recovery flow re-seeds accounts from the nightly snapshot. Check that the importer skips locked accounts — last time it didn't. To rerun recovery against staging you'll need the vault passphrase, which is appended just below.

recovery phrase for yafof-tajof: julmir-kelax-julvan-holath-belvan-holir-ralael-ralvan-ralath-julvan-silmir-istmir-kaswyn-ulamir